Charlie is now 14 years 3 months, I can't seem to find anyone who has had a Pug live this long! He has such a will to live, he can't see much, hears nothing and has no teeth, his back legs are all but gone but he still gets up and walks for his tea and water! Is this a good age!

K-9 Ava : German Shepherd Dog

Dogs name: K-9 Ava
Owners Name: Buddy
Ava is a 4 1/2 year old sable GSD. She is a big girl standing 26 inches at the withers and weighing 97 pounds. Ava is a certified search and rescue dog specializing in area search. Thankfully, all the searches she has been deployed on have ended on a happy note. She would prefer to work at night in cold temperatures but is willing to work all day in the blazing sun if asked to. She trains at least four hours a week with some weeks training lasting a lot longer.
